Fundamentals show pressure in the US sportsbook segment
Flutter’s most recent quarterly reporting highlighted that the US business, anchored by FanDuel, has faced short-term headwinds. As TS2.tech reported on September 11, 2026, Flutter’s second quarter release showed U.S. revenue down 6 percent year on year and sportsbook revenue down 15 percent, reflecting unfavorable sports results and intensifying competition.
The same article notes that the Washington, D.C. market generated only 6.13 million dollars of gross gaming revenue in July 2026, underscoring that individual state developments can affect marketing costs and margins without materially changing consolidated revenue. According to TS2.tech, Flutter’s exposure to this specific market is therefore limited in absolute numbers, but the entry of Bet365 raises the risk that customer acquisition in the US becomes more expensive for FanDuel over time.
Consensus revenue and earnings expectations for 2026
Despite the second quarter pressure in the US sportsbook division, analyst consensus estimates imply continued growth at the group level. According to Yahoo Finance on September 11, 2026, the average estimate for Flutter Entertainment’s revenue in the current quarter ending September 2026 stands at 4.04 billion dollars, while the next quarter ending December 2026 is projected at 5.22 billion dollars.
For the full fiscal year 2026, the same consensus overview shows average revenue expectations of 17.93 billion dollars, compared with 17.65 billion dollars at the low end and 18.34 billion dollars at the high end of analyst forecasts. According to Yahoo Finance, the current year estimate implies a modest increase versus prior-year reported revenue levels, while projections for 2027 rise to 19.46 billion dollars at the consensus level.
On the earnings side, the same set of analysts expects an average earnings per share of 0.32 dollars in the quarter ending September 2026 and 2.98 dollars in the quarter ending December 2026. For the full fiscal year 2026, average EPS estimates stand at 5.01 dollars, with a range from 3.05 dollars at the low end to 7.50 dollars at the high end. These figures, compiled by Yahoo Finance, frame the expectations that underpin the current analyst price targets.
